Stay Safe on UK Motorways
If your vehicle breaks down on a motorway, safety is your top priority. Pull onto the hard shoulder if possible, turn on your hazard lights, and leave the vehicle through the left-hand doors. Stand behind the safety barrier, away from the motorway, and wear a high-visibility jacket if you have one. Call your recovery provider or the emergency services immediately.
Know Your Vehicle Recovery Options
Breakdown recovery services generally offer two options: roadside assistance or vehicle towing. Roadside assistance involves a technician attempting to repair the vehicle on the spot. If the fault cannot be resolved, they will arrange a vehicle tow to transport your car to a local garage or your home address.
Response Times and Customer Support
When you call for recovery, provide your exact location (using motorway marker posts or apps like What3Words). Ask the operator for an estimated arrival time so you know when to expect the technician. A reliable recovery firm will keep you updated throughout the process.
